There are different forms of Discord malware, and each has its own way of spreading and infecting your devices.
1. Corrupted Discord installation file
Users can modify their Discord Javascript files. If a cybercriminal gains user permission, they can add malicious code to Discord's client files. Once users launch the file, they also execute the code. The hacker can then access the user's Discord data.
This attack is particularly difficult to detect. Antivirus software will probably not recognize the corrupt code. However, if Discord detects that someone modified the files while it's updating, it warns the user and asks whether to continue to run the client. You can also check files manually for suspicious additions. You can find lots of info online on what to look for.

The first attack mainly focuses on getting users to install discord through a tampered installer, quite a basic premise of other software that requires you to install files as well. Bottom line for this is only install discord through official releases on their site.
The second attack focuses on social engineering, where phishing links are sent via discord. Again quite a simple premise that many other instant messaging apps can fall prey to, even telegram, whatsapp or signal. Bottom line is don't open any strange links that people you don't personally know send you, even if you've supposedly "won" $1 000 000.
I don't think completely faulting discord on these 2 attacks are justified, yes they should be able to do more to prevent this, however it's also your own responsibility as a user to check the installer file you have is from a reputable source and also the links you click in the app are from someone you know.
